School Overview
Hawthorne Math and Science Academy (HMSA) is a high-performing, public charter school located in Hawthorne, California, serving students in grades 9 through 12. Founded with a rigorous focus on college preparation, the school distinguishes itself through a specialized curriculum that emphasizes science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M). HMSA consistently ranks among the top high schools in the state and nation, known for its small-school environment and its commitment to ensuring that its student body—largely composed of underrepresented groups—attains the academic qualifications necessary for admission to prestigious universities, including the University of California system.

Beyond its academic rigor, the school is recognized for its disciplined culture and high expectations for student achievement. HMSA operates under the Leona Group and maintains a structured, supportive atmosphere where students are encouraged to pursue advanced coursework, including a significant number of Advanced Placement (AP) classes. By blending a demanding academic workload with comprehensive college counseling, Hawthorne Math and Science Academy has built a reputation as a bridge to higher education, providing high-quality STEM-focused instruction to the local community.
